Fright Fest Stage Manager / Sound Technician - $14.45/ HR - Six Flags - Eureka, MO


Job Summary: Prepare, operate, and oversee the daily operation of Entertainment venues, shows, and events.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Maintain overall Theatre and stage cleanliness in a safe and efficient manner
  • Support and promote a Guest First philosophy
  • Clearly communicate general information and direction to team members and Guests
  • Assist team members and guests in problem solving
  • Ensure consistent inventory and maintenance of theatre equipment.
  • Perform light and sound checks daily, troubleshoot, and be able to change lamps and/or microphones
  • Help cast, crew, and ushers daily to maintain top quality shows and performances
  • Ensure all aspects of theatre is prepped and in operational order for each performance
  • Operate and maintain the technical equipment used for the show
  • Monitor audio signals and adjust microphones if needed
  • Keep up on inventory and maintenance of theatre equipment

  • Meet and greet guests in a friendly and positive manner at all times
  • Assist in training new team members on operating procedures
  • Complete reports, maintenance reports and training records as necessary
  • Ensure that all employees adhere to the set schedules, including clocking in/out for shifts and breaks
  • Ensure all shows begin promptly on time
  • Must adhere to the grooming code
  • Develop prompt book/appropriate paperwork to run show by opening day of show
  • Assists with tasks in the park or venue as needed or deemed necessary
  • Must assist with washing and drying costumes daily as scheduled

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• Must be able to lift up to 60 lbs.
  • Must maintain a positive attitude and working environment
  • Must be able to cooperate well with other management staff
  • Must be able to comply with Six Flags policies, including all safety and leadership standards
  • Must be willing to train crew members
  • Must be willing to work without a crew
  • Must be able to handle stress.
  • Must have the ability to prioritize
  • Be willing to give disciplinary action when needed
  • Must be able to trouble shoot problems and identify solutions
  • Must be able to work at heights exceeding 50 ft.
  • Must be able to handle confidential information
  • Must have strong work ethics and communication skills
  • Must be self-sufficient
  • Must be able to work in all weather conditions including heat, rain, wind, snow, cold and storms
  • Must have good leadership skills, be trustworthy and work well with other team members
  • Must be able to work a flexible schedule that includes nights, weekends, and holidays
  • Other: Requires additional interview
